From picosecond pump-probe and forward degenerate four-wave mixing (DFWM) experiments, we obtain the near-band-gap nonlinear absorption and refraction properties of GaInAsP for 1.5micron radiation. Using a mode-locked color center laser, the nonlinear signals are studied in room temperature samples as a function of time wavelength for different pump energies. Nonlinear absorption cross-sections (sigma)(eh) as large as 5.7x10(-15) cm(2) are obtained from the pump-probe results, while effective nonlinear cross-sections (sigma)(eff) as large as 9x10(-16) cm(2) (corresponding to a steady state |x(3)|~4.4x10(-3) e.s.u. for a 20 nsec relaxation time) are measured in the DFWM experiments.
